helo=us-smtp-delivery-124.mimecast.com X-Spam_score_int: -31 X-Spam_score: -3.2 X-Spam_bar: --- X-Spam_report: (-3.2 / 5.0 requ) BAYES_00=-1.9, DKIMWL_WL_HIGH=-0.386, DKIM_SIGNED=0.1, DKIM_VALID=-0.1, DKIM_VALID_AU=-0.1, DKIM_VALID_EF=-0.1, RCVD_IN_DNSWL_LOW=-0.7, RCVD_IN_MSPIKE_H4=0.001, RCVD_IN_MSPIKE_WL=0.001, SPF_HELO_NONE=0.001, SPF_PASS=-0.001 autolearn=ham autolearn_force=no X-Spam_action: no action X-BeenThere: qemu-devel@nongnu.org X-Mailman-Version: 2.1.23 Precedence: list List-Id: List-Unsubscribe: , List-Archive: List-Post: List-Help: List-Subscribe: , Cc: Kevin Wolf , Vladimir Sementsov-Ogievskiy , Alberto Garcia , "open list:Throttling infras..." , Max Reitz Errors-To: qemu-devel-bounces+incoming=patchwork.ozlabs.org@nongnu.org Sender: "Qemu-devel" From: Vladimir Sementsov-Ogievskiy The function is called from 64bit io handlers, and bytes is just passed to throttle_account() which is 64bit too (unsigned though). So, let's convert intermediate argument to 64bit too. This patch is a first in the 64-bit-blocklayer series, so we are generally moving to int64_t for both offset and bytes parameters on all io paths. Main motivation is realization of 64-bit write_zeroes operation for fast zeroing large disk chunks, up to the whole disk. We chose signed type, to be consistent with off_t (which is signed) and with possibility for signed return type (where negative value means error). Patch-correctness audit by Eric Blake: Caller has 32-bit, this patch now causes widening which is safe: block/block-backend.c: blk_do_preadv() passes 'unsigned int' block/block-backend.c: blk_do_pwritev_part() passes 'unsigned int' block/throttle.c: throttle_co_pwrite_zeroes() passes 'int' block/throttle.c: throttle_co_pdiscard() passes 'int' Caller has 64-bit, this patch fixes potential bug where pre-patch could narrow, except it's easy enough to trace that callers are still capped at 2G actions: block/throttle.c: throttle_co_preadv() passes 'uint64_t' block/throttle.c: throttle_co_pwritev() passes 'uint64_t' Implementation in question: block/throttle-groups.c throttle_group_co_io_limits_intercept() takes 'unsigned int bytes' and uses it: argument to util/throttle.c throttle_account(uint64_t) All safe: it patches a latent bug, and does not introduce any 64-bit gotchas once throttle_co_p{read,write}v are relaxed, and assuming throttle_account() is not buggy. helo=us-smtp-delivery-124.mimecast.com X-Spam_score_int: -31 X-Spam_score: -3.2 X-Spam_bar: --- X-Spam_report: (-3.2 / 5.0 requ) BAYES_00=-1.9, DKIMWL_WL_HIGH=-0.386, DKIM_SIGNED=0.1, DKIM_VALID=-0.1, DKIM_VALID_AU=-0.1, DKIM_VALID_EF=-0.1, RCVD_IN_DNSWL_LOW=-0.7, RCVD_IN_MSPIKE_H3=0.001, RCVD_IN_MSPIKE_WL=0.001, SPF_HELO_NONE=0.001, SPF_PASS=-0.001 autolearn=unavailable autolearn_force=no X-Spam_action: no action X-BeenThere: qemu-devel@nongnu.org X-Mailman-Version: 2.1.23 Precedence: list List-Id: List-Unsubscribe: , List-Archive: List-Post: List-Help: List-Subscribe: , Cc: Roman Kagan , Kevin Wolf , Vladimir Sementsov-Ogievskiy , "open list:Network Block Dev..." , Max Reitz Errors-To: qemu-devel-bounces+incoming=patchwork.ozlabs.org@nongnu.org Sender: "Qemu-devel" From: Roman Kagan When the reconnect in NBD client is in progress, the iochannel used for NBD connection doesn't exist. Therefore an attempt to detach it from the aio_context of the parent BlockDriverState results in a NULL pointer dereference. The problem is triggerable, in particular, when an outgoing migration is about to finish, and stopping the dataplane tries to move the BlockDriverState from the iothread aio_context to the main loop. This error code is propagated from the primitives like nbd_read. The problem, however, is that nbd_read itself turns every error into -1 rather than -EIO. As a result, if the NBD server happens to die while sending the message, the client in QEMU receives less data than it expects, considers it as a fatal error, and wouldn't attempt reestablishing the connection. Fix it by turning every negative return from qio_channel_read_all into -EIO returned from nbd_read. Apparently that was the original behavior, but got broken later. Also adjust nbd_readXX to follow.
